South Lineville has a very low overall natural hazard risk rating according to FEMA's National Risk Index. The top hazard risks are landslide, drought, wildfire. The area has had 19 federal disaster declarations. The most common disaster type is severe storm (10 declarations). FEMA has obligated $781,844 in public assistance recovery funding.
